我正在尝试重新启动 httpd 但出现以下错误
$ systemctl restart httpd
Error getting authority: Error initializing authority: Could not connect: No such file or directory (g-io-error-quark, 1)
经过调查发现这是一个 dbus 问题,尝试使用 REST dbus 但出现与上面相同的错误。检查 /var/log/messages 后,我收到以下错误:
<info> [1559812709.0738] bus-manager: could not connect to the system bus (Could not connect: No such file or directory); only the private D-Bus socket will be available
Jun 6 14:48:32 db1 NetworkManager[329115]: <info> [1559812712.0731] bus-manager: could not connect to the system bus (Could not connect: No such file or directory); only the private D-Bus socket will be available
$ cat /etc/redhat-release
CentOS Linux release 7.5.1804 (Core)
注意:/var
并且/
位于同一分区,而且我无法重新启动 NetworkManager
答案1
我也遇到同样的问题,误删除/var/run
了。
解决重新创建链接:
ln -s /run/dbus /var/run/dbus
来源
bwrap:无法在 /var/run 处创建符号链接:文件存在 · 问题 #2200 · flatpak/flatpak